The cheapest way to get from Charlottesville to Philadelphia is to drive which costs $45 - $70 and takes 4h 52m.
The fastest way to get from Charlottesville to Philadelphia is to fly and train which takes 4h 6m and costs $100 - $1,000.
No, there is no direct train from Charlottesville to Philadelphia station. However, there are services departing from Charlottesville and arriving at 30th Street Station via Washington Union Station.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 4h 27m.
The distance between Charlottesville and Philadelphia is 246 miles. The road distance is 251 miles.
The best way to get from Charlottesville to Philadelphia without a car is to train which takes 4h 27m and costs $65 - $160.
It takes approximately 4h 27m to get from Charlottesville to Philadelphia, including transfers.
Charlottesville to Philadelphia train services, operated by Amtrak, depart from Charlottesville station.
Charlottesville to Philadelphia train services, operated by Amtrak, arrive at Washington Union Station.
Yes, the driving distance between Charlottesville to Philadelphia is 251 miles. It takes approximately 4h 52m to drive from Charlottesville to Philadelphia.
